Understanding the Link Between NSAIDs and Elevated Blood Pressure
Back pain is a common ailment that affects countless individuals, often prompting medical professionals to prescribe nonsteroidal anti-inflammatory drugs (NSAIDs) as a remedy. While these medications can provide significant relief, they can also introduce unintended side effects—most notably, spikes in blood pressure. A reader recently shared their alarming experience of elevated blood pressure, reaching 198/90, after taking NSAIDs for back pain. Many others have reported similar concerns, raising questions about the safety and mechanisms involved in NSAID usage.
The Science Behind NSAIDs and Blood Pressure
According to various medical studies, NSAIDs like ibuprofen, naproxen, and diclofenac have been associated with increases in blood pressure among both normotensive and hypertensive individuals. The average rise is often modest (approximately 3 mmHg systolic), yet in certain cases, as echoed by the reader's experience, the spikes can be dramatic. This spike is attributed to the inhibition of cyclooxygenase-2 (COX-2) in the kidneys, reducing sodium excretion and consequently raising intravascular volume—key factors contributing to heightened blood pressure.

A Broader Perspective: Differentiating NSAIDs and Their Effects
While navigating pain relief options, it's crucial to understand that not all NSAIDs influence blood pressure in the same way. For instance, low-dose aspirin primarily does not demonstrate any prohypertensive effects. In contrast, ibuprofen has been shown to increase the incidence of new hypertension significantly. Individuals considering NSAIDs for pain must weigh these differences and consult their healthcare providers to ascertain the appropriate choice tailored to their health profiles.
